Men’s Swimming & Diving Hosts Buffalo this Weekend

Ray DeWire

NIAGARA UN., N.Y. – The Niagara University men’s (0-1) swimming and diving team is back in action Saturday at the Oxy Aquatic Center at 1p.m., taking on the University at Buffalo (1-0).

The Purple Eagles dropped their first meet of the season to Duquesne, 109-84. Sophomore Zak Brown (Bakersfield Calif.) finished second in the 1,000 freestyle and junior Pat Garvey (Pine Bush, N.Y.) finished second in the men’s 200 freestyle, despite losing to the Dukes.

Buffalo (1-0) is coming off a season-opening victory, defeating Ball State, 136-107, Oct. 27.

Niagara is in search of its first victory against Buffalo, having dropped the last four meetings between the two teams.
